    About Meridian Energy Ltd

    Meridian Energy is one of New Zealand's leading utilities. It is the largest electricity producer in the nation, with a third of the market, and the fourth-largest energy retailer, with about 15% of the market by customer numbers. It generates 100% renewable electricity, mainly from large hydroelectric schemes in the South Island. It also owns a geographically diversified portfolio of wind farms.

    Ms Janice (Jan) Amelia Dawson Non-Executive Director Nov 2012
    Ms Dawson is Chair of Westpac New Zealand, Deputy Chair of Air New Zealand Limited, Director of AIG Insurance New Zealand Limited and Beca Group. She was previously the Chair and Chief Executive of KPMG New Zealand with a career spanning 30 years specialising in audit and accounting services in the United Kingdom, Canada and New Zealand. She is a Vice President of World Sailing a Councillor of the University of Auckland. She was previously President of Yachting New Zealand and a director of Goodman Fielder Limited and Counties Manukau District Health Board. She is Chair of the People Committee and a member of Risk Committee.
